  • I can send it to you both.  I think we were getting a deal on it though, but they did a good job, and even put lights around the edges and stamped a compass on our friends patio.  The last quote we got was just under $5k.

    The one thing I didn't realize is that it does have some upkeep...I guess you have to reglaze it every 2 years and it's about $250-300 for someone to do that.  I never knew that and the other contractor didn't tell us that.

    We could have re-sealed ours this year (it needs it) but we're waiting until next year, at which point we'll have had it three years.  You can re-seal it yourself, you don't need to have someone do it for you.  It's basically this stuff you spray on.

    It's a mess getting it done--when they stamp it they throw this powder on top of the cement (helps give it kind of like a two tone look) and that powder gets everywhere.  The company we used was VERY good about cleaning everything up, and they don't drive all over your lawn with the cement either.  They lay down boards and drive the little buggy on the boards when bringing the cement to the area getting done.
